The College Education Training programs aims to overcome high unemployment rates by providing an opportunity for hands-on, skilled education over a period of two to three years that allows youth to compete in the job market or become job creators themselves. Ideally, these skills will allow youth to serve the needs of their local village once they graduate. Since the program’s launch in 2016, 100% of our graduates have secured permanent jobs,oftentimes being hired before graduation with certificates in preschool and elementary education, nursing/midwifery, carpentry, catering, seamstresses, veterinary, mechanics, hairdressing, and electrical engineering.
The Life Skills Program offers students the opportunity to reach their full potential through academic scholarships, vocational skill building, personal and professional development courses, and a school feeding program.
The Collegiate Education Training Program combats Uganda’s high unemployment rates by offering students the opportunity to continue their education by learning a trade that addresses a local need or service.
The Seeding Success programs equip current or aspiring farmers with the skills needed to expand their crop production and income through technical training, business management courses, and hands-on technical support using a cost-effective approach to sustainable farming.
The Women’s Enterprise Training Program supports women in launching or expanding a family business through business management courses, skill building, and start-up funding, making their dream of attaining economic self-sufficiency and food security a reality.
